Hiking during the rainy season can be a tough sell because let’s be real: No one likes getting soaked outdoors. But once you know how to do it, going for a hike in the rain comes with some perks you won’t get at any other time of year. Today on City Cast Portland, host Claudia Meza is talking with Norther Emily of Wild Solitude Guiding. She has some picks for where you should visit when the rain falls — and how to maybe even stay dry while you’re doing it.
